Friday, August 27, 1971
page B11
ARTA JEAN K. SESSIONS
Kearns - Funeral services will be Friday noon, 6500 S. Redwood Rd., for Arta Jean Keil Sessions, 45, 4388 W. 4745 South, who was dead on arrival at a Granger hospital Aug. 23 of natural causes. Born Oct. 29, 1925, Salt Lake City, to Walter Lionel and Mabel Coonrad Keil. Married Wesley W. Sessions, May 12, 1949, Salt Lake City. Member Episcopal Church.
Survivors: husband; daughters, Mrs. Douglas G. (Vicke Jean) Bosen, Mountain Home Air Force Base, Idaho; Mrs. Charles L. (Debra Kay) Divinety Jr., Ft. Bragg, N.C.; brothers, sisters, Frank Alan Keil, Granger; Walter L. Keil, Los Angeles; Mrs. Arthur L. (Shirley) Tripp, Salt Lake City; Mrs. Alvin T. (Helen) Bleak, Logan.
Friends call 6500 S. Redwood Rd. Friday one hour prior to services. Burial Redwood Memorial Estates.
